ocarina in American English
a small, simple wind instrument shaped like a sweet potato, with finger holes and a mouthpiece: it produces soft, hollow tones
noun: a simple musical wind instrument shaped somewhat like an elongated egg with a mouthpiece and finger holes

ocarina in British English
noun: an egg-shaped wind instrument with a protruding mouthpiece and six to eight finger holes, producing an almost pure tone
